Description

Dianhydroaurasperone C is a specialized fungal metabolite belonging to the class of bis-naphtho-γ-pyrones. This compound is valued for its unique chemical scaffold, which serves as a critical reference standard and a promising lead structure in advanced research and development. It is primarily sought by professionals in pharmaceutical discovery, natural product chemistry, and biotechnology for investigating bioactivity and developing novel synthetic pathways.

Basic Information

Product Name Dianhydroaurasperone C
CAS No. 92280-05-2
Molecular Formula C30H22O10
Molecular Weight 542.49 g/mol
Synonyms Dianhydro-aurasperone C; Aurasperone F; Bis-naphtho-γ-pyrone derivative; 6,6'-Bis(5,7-dihydroxy-4-methyl-1-oxo-1H-naphtho[2,3-c]pyran-3-yl)-3,3'-dimethyl[2,2'-bipyran]-5,5'(4H,4'H)-dione; Fungal metabolite from *Aspergillus niger*.
